Title: Senior Solutions Architect

Requisition ID: 247210

Join a purpose driven winning team, committed to results, in an inclusive and high‑performingIGN culture.

In this role you will:

  • Scalable Architecture: Design and implement scalable, secure, and high‑performance solutions tailored toAnti Money Laundering
  • Business Alignment: Collaborate closely with business stakeholders to gather requirements and translate them into robust, future‑proof technical solutions.
  • Technical Mentorship: Provide hands‑on guidance and mentorship to engineering teams, fostering growth and ensuring technical excellence.
  • Standards Compliance: Ensure all solutions adhere to enterprise architecture principles, regulatory requirements, and industry best practices.
  • Modular Modernization: Spearhead modernization efforts including cloud‑native adoption, microservices architecture, and modular API‑first design. Drive loosely coupled components to enable flexibility, scalability, and vendor independence.
  • Platform Enablement: Build foundational capabilities that empower product, data, and AI teams to innovate securely and efficiently.
  • AI Integration: Architect and integrate AI/ML capabilities into platforms to enhance advisor productivity, personalization, and decision support.
  • Data Engineering: Design and optimize real‑time and batch data pipelines for analytics, reporting, and AI model consumption.
  • Operational Excellence: Support production systems with a focus on reliability, scalability, and continuous service improvement.
  • DevOps Enablement: Champion DevOps practicesIST such as CI/CD pipelines, automated testing, observability, and infrastructure as code.
  • Stakeholder Communication: Communicate complex technical concepts clearly to both technical and non‑technical stakeholders, facilitating consensus and alignment.
  • Continuously Improve: Aid in the continuous improvement of business and technical processes through prior experiences and best practice adoption.
  • Understand how the Bank’s risk appetite and risk culture should be considered in day‑to‑day activities and decisions.
(indent)

Do you have the skills that will enable you to succeed in this role?

  • 10+ years of software engineering experience.
  • Bachelor (equivalent or higher) deg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or related discipline.
  • 5+ Experience working in the Banking and Financial Services domain
  • Excellent Understanding of Anti Money Laundering Domain and Data: Payments Screening, Name Screening , Transactions Monitoring , Data Management (Client, Positions, Transactions etc.), AML Operations comprende, SARs, Case Management, Investigation reporting and Analytics etc.)
  • Experience with structured Architecture practices, hybrid cloud deployments, and on‑premises to cloud migration deployments and roadmaps.
  • Experience building, architecting, designing, and implementing highly distributed global oriented systems. Experience in network infrastructure, security, data, or application development.
  • Experience in modernizing legacy systems or similar transformational initiatives
  • Excellent interpersonal, communication, and influencing skills with the ability to build and foster relationships with business partners, project stakeholders, strategic technology partners and external vendors.
